Fact Checks (4)
"Ron DeSantis is really being punished in the Polls / falling in polls"
Mostly True

DeSantis peaked in national primary polling in January-February 2023 and was in measurable decline by June 2023, following a troubled campaign launch and Trump attacks.

"Falling at a level rarely seen in American politics"
Mostly False

DeSantis's decline was notable but comparable to other early-frontrunner collapses (Giuliani 2008, Scott Walker 2015). Hyperbolic framing without comparative evidence.

"Prior to Trump's endorsement, his campaign was DEAD"
Half True

Trump's May 2018 endorsement was material in DeSantis's narrow 2018 Republican primary win. However, DeSantis had already developed a national profile through Fox News appearances and was competitive. His 2022 re-election by 19 points reflected substantial independent political brand development.

"What Trump did for DeSantis was 'artificial' inflation of his numbers"
Mostly False

While Trump's 2018 endorsement aided DeSantis's initial rise, framing his entire political career as 'artificial' inflation contradicts DeSantis's substantial 2022 electoral performance and independent conservative policy record in Florida.
